Mykhaylo Mudryk’s Arsenal transfer has been rumored since the summer. Will all the talk turn into action in January? The Athletic says it’s possible.
The Kroenke family reportedly wants to back sporting director Edu and manager Mikel Arteta, with Mudryk their ‘primary’ target after contacting his representation. Sources say there’s a ‘good probability’ the sale will go through, but nothing is finalized.
Gabriel Jesus’ knee injury might keep him out for three months, making Arsenal’s ambitions to boost the frontline even more imperative.
